MySQL
多表关系
一对多
创建数据表
sql
# 创建班级表(主表)
create table class(
cid int primary key, -- 设置为主键
cname varchar(20)
);
# 创建学生表(从表)
create table student(
sid int,
cname varchar(20),
class_id int -- 设置为外键
);
建立多表之间的关系
sql
# alter table 从表表名 add constraint [外键名称] foreign key(外键字段) references 主表表名(主键字段)
alter table student add constraint student_fk foreign key (class_id) references class(cid);
填充数据
sql
# 班级(主表)
insert into class values(1, '1班');
insert into class values(2, '2班');
# 学生(从表)
insert into student values(1, 'zs', 1);
insert into student values(2, 'zs', 1);
注意事项
sql
# 失败:主表中不存在cid=3的数据
insert into student values(3, 'zs', 3);
# 失败:不能删除已经被从表使用的数据
delete from class where cid = 1;
多对多
sql
# 创建学生表(主表)
create table student(
sid varchar(10) primary key, -- 设置为主键
sname varchar(20)
);
# 创建课程表(主表)
create table course(
cid varchar(10) primary key, -- 设置为主键
cname varchar(20)
);
# 中间表
create table midde(
student_id varchar(10), -- 设置为外键
course_id varchar(10) -- 设置为外键
);
# 建立多对多的关系
alter table midde add constraint student_fk foreign key (student_id) references student(sid);
alter table midde add constraint course_fk foreign key (course_id) references course(cid);

多表查询
交叉查询
sql
# 查询两个表的数据
select * from student, course;
内连接查询
查询所有学生和课程数据
sql
# 隐式内连接查询
select s.name, c.name from student s, course c where s.sid = c.cid;
# 显示内连接查询
select s.name, c.name from student s inner join course c on s.sid = c.cid;
外连接查询
sql
# 左外连接:查询左表student的所有数据,如果条件成立则显示右表course的数据,反之显示null
select * from student s left outer join course c on s.sid = c.cid;
# 右外连接:查询右表course的所有数据,如果条件成立则显示右表student的数据,反之显示null
select * from course c right outer join student s on c.cid = s.sid;

子表查询
标量子查询
查询 emp
员工与对应的 dept
部门名称
sql
# select deptno from dept where deptno = 10;
select e.ename, (select dname from dept where e.deptno = deptno) as dept from emp e;
列子查询
查询编号为 7369
和 7521
的员工并显示部门信息
sql
# 找到指定编号的员工
#select e.ename from emp e where e.empno in (7369, 7521);
# 再通过指定编号找到员工的部门
#select d.dname from dept d where e.deptno = d.deptno;
select e.ename, (select d.dname from dept d where e.deptno = d.deptno) as dept from emp e where e.empno in (7369, 7521);
查询 sales
与 accounting
这两个部门的所有员工姓名
sql
# select deptno as id from dept where dname in ('sales', 'accounting');
select ename from emp where deptno in (select deptno as id from dept where dname in ('sales', 'accounting'));
查询在 blake
入职之后的员工数据
sql
# select hiredate from emp where ename = 'blake';
select ename, hiredate from emp where hiredate < (select hiredate from emp where ename = 'blake');
行子查询
查询与其入职日期 及 职位都相同的员工信息
sql
# select * from emp where hiredate = '2007-01-01' and job = 2;
# 方式一
select * from emp where hiredate = (select hiredate from emp where ename = '韦一笑') and job = (select job from emp where ename = '韦一笑');
# 方式二:简化上述代码
select * from emp where (hiredate, job) = (select hiredate, job from emp where ename = '韦一笑');
表子查询
查询 emp
表的所有信息,以及 dept
表的 dname
sql
select e.*, d.dname as dept from emp e, dept d where e.deptno = d.DEPTNO;
